Kildare Senior Hurling panel to play Kerry in Round 3 of the Joe McDonagh Cup
David Herity and his management team have named the Kildare Senior Hurling panel to play Kerry in Round 3 of the Joe McDonagh Cup in Manguard Plus Hawkfield on Saturday, April 22nd at 1pm.
